Drive to the western Cape Kormakitis/Koruçam. This is where the hike begins, always heading east to Cape Zafer, 260 kilometres away, the easternmost point and final destination of the entire trail. The varied trail first leads along the coast and then winds its way up to the lower western ridge line of the Besparmak Mountains. To the east you can see the mountain range, to the south the Troodos massif rises and to the north the clear blue of the Mediterranean shimmers. Along fields, pine trees and fragrant maquis, the path ends in the village of Koruçam. The day's destination has been reached! A Greek/Türkish coffee tastes simply marvellous in Maria's village restaurant. Overnight stay at the Hotel Lapida o.s. Easy hike approx. 4 hours.
The Crusader castle of St Hilarion is one of the historical highlights that mark the trail. After the ascent and visit to the castle, the ascending hike begins on the south side of the mountain to an overgrown high plateau with magnificent views of Girne and the sea. After crossing the ridge, the path leads down the wooded north side to the village of Bellapais. The Gothic abbey is situated on the slopes of Bellapais. After a coffee break, visit the former monastery complex. Overnight stay in Bellapais Hotel Ambelia o.s.
Medium-difficulty hike approx. 5.5 hours.
After checking out, drive to the Besparmak Pass. The striking 750 metre high mountain rises like a fist clenched in the air above the sea. Today's hike continues eastwards along this legendary mountain to the Alevkaya picnic area. Green pines, dark cypresses and red-stemmed strawberry bushes grow along the path and form a canopy of shade until you reach the abandoned Armenian monastery of Sourp Magar. Again and again, the view sweeps over the coast and the mountain range. After a short climb, you reach the Alevkaya picnic area. Possibility to visit the herbarium. Overnight stay at the Sinya Guesthouse o.s.
Easy hike approx. 3.5 hours.
Drive along the north coast to Mersinlik. Above the village, the hike begins through young pine forests to the small village of Kantara. After a short rest, the hike continues along the mountain ridge to the mountain fortress Kantara. Marvellous views over the coast and the plain of Mesaria delight the eye until you reach the castle. The mighty castle rises 650 metres above the sea at the beginning of the Karpaz peninsula. If visibility is good, you can almost see the final destination - Cape Zafer. Hike back to the village to the new accommodation. Overnight stay in Büyükkonuk o. s.
Easy hike approx. 4 hours.
The hike starts directly from the accommodation and leads to the village centre with the mosque and the Orthodox church. After leaving the village centre, the path winds steadily downhill to a plateau with olive groves. With the blue sea in front of you, you reach the northern coast. Follow the coastline for a while, then the path leads inland and the crossing of the Karpaz peninsula from the south coast to the north coast begins. After a short climb, you reach a plateau with carob trees. The descent now begins via a path towards the north coast to the abandoned churches of Panagia Aphendrika, Asomatos and Agios Georgios. Overnight stay in one of the agritourism centres in Dipkarpaz Medium-difficulty hike approx. 4.5 hours.
After checking out, we first leave Dipkarpaz in a southerly direction to the starting point of the last hike. Scattered juniper bushes and carob trees grow in the narrow plains along the ridge. Towards Cape Zafer, the path meets the coast again. The gentle green hills, the sandy path and the turquoise blue sea create a harmonious picture of this unspoilt landscape. Lone hikers can be seen among the juniper bushes - the wild donkeys of the Karpaz. The mighty cliffs of Cape Zafer with the offshore Klidhes Islands are close enough to touch. The last stretch is now quickly completed and the southernmost point of Europe, the final high point of the hike, is reached. Overnight stay in one of the agrotourism huts in Dipkarpaz. Easy hike approx. 4 hours
